		<description><![CDATA[What is with your dog food, do you know? Have you thought about switching brands or formulas but aren&#8217;t sure where to look to compare?

DogFoodAnalysis.com keeps on top of current changes in all major brands and formulas of dog foods sold commercially, and keeps them all in one huge alphabetical directory, as well as a listing by review ranking.
Each listed brand or formula gives the rundown of what the food contains, and gives an editor&#8217;s review of what it all means and if they&#8217;d recommend it.
They also have a FAQ and a resource center with recommended books and links.
